如何通过shell脚本自动生成vue文件详解

yizhihongxing

以下是关于“如何通过shell脚本自动生成vue文件”的完整攻略,其中包含两个示例说明。

1. 前言

在Vue.js项目中,我们经常需要创建新的Vue组件。本攻略将详细讲解如何通过shell脚本自动生成Vue文件,以提高开发效率。

2. 示例一:使用echo命令生成Vue文件

以下是使用echo命令生成Vue文件的示例:

#!/bin/bash

# 定义组件名称
component_name="MyComponent"

# 生成Vue文件
echo "<template>
  <div>
    <h1>$component_name</h1>
  </div>
</template>

<script>
export default {
  name: '$component_name'
}
</script>

<style scoped>
</style>" > "$component_name.vue"

在本示例中,我们定义了一个组件名称component_name,然后使用echo命令生成Vue文件。Vue文件包括template、script和style三个部分,其中template部分包含组件的HTML模板,script部分包含组件的JavaScript代码,style部分包含组件的CSS样式。

3. 示例二:使用cat命令生成Vue文件

以下是使用cat命令生成Vue文件的示例:

#!/bin/bash

# 定义组件名称
component_name="MyComponent"

# 生成Vue文件
cat << EOF > "$component_name.vue"
<template>
  <div>
    <h1>$component_name</h1>
  </div>
</template>

<script>
export default {
  name: '$component_name'
}
</script>

<style scoped>
</style>
EOF

在本示例中,我们同样定义了一个组件名称component_name,然后使用cat命令生成Vue文件。与示例一不同的是,我们使用了EOF(End of File)标记来表示文件的结束,这样可以在文件中包含多行文本。

4. 总结

本攻略详细讲解了如何通过shell脚本自动生成Vue文件,包括使用echo命令和cat命令生成Vue文件。同时,提供了两个使用这些方法生成Vue文件的示例,帮助读者更好地了解和使用这些方法。通过自动生成Vue文件,可以提高开发效率,减少手动创建文件的时间和工作量。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:如何通过shell脚本自动生成vue文件详解 - Python技术站

(0)
上一篇 2023年5月16日
下一篇 2023年5月16日

相关文章

  • Shell脚本调用另一个脚本的三种方法

    以下是关于“Shell脚本调用另一个脚本的三种方法”的完整攻略,其中包含两个示例说明。 1. 调用另一个脚本的三种方法 在Shell脚本中,有多种方法可以调用另一个脚本,以下是其中的三种方法: 1.1 直接调用 直接调用另一个脚本是最常见的方法,只需要在当前脚本中输入另一个脚本的路径,即可调用另一个脚本。例如: #!/bin/bash # 直接调用 ./te…

    Shell 2023年5月16日
    00
  • shell脚本编程之if语句学习笔记

    以下是关于“shell脚本编程之if语句学习笔记”的完整攻略,其中包含两个示例说明。 1. 前言 if语句是Shell脚本编程中非常常用的一种语句,可以根据条件执行不同的命令。本攻略将介绍if语句的语法、使用方法和示例。 2. 语法 if语句的语法如下: if condition then command1 command2 … else command…

    Shell 2023年5月16日
    00
  • Shell中if的基本语法和常见判断用法

    以下是关于“Shell中if的基本语法和常见判断用法”的完整攻略,其中包含两个示例说明。 1. Shell中if的基本语法 在Shell脚本中,if语句是一种常用的条件判断结构,用于根据条件执行不同的命令。以下是if语句的基本语法: if 条件 then 命令1 else 命令2 fi 其中,条件表示要判断的条件,命令1表示条件成立时要执行的命令,命令2表示…

    Shell 2023年5月16日
    00
  • 一天一个shell命令 linux文本操作系列-touch命令用法

    以下是关于“一天一个shell命令 linux文本操作系列-touch命令用法”的完整攻略,其中包含两个示例说明。 1. 前言 在Linux系统中,touch命令是一个非常常用的命令,它可以用来创建空文件或者修改文件的时间戳。本攻略将介绍touch命令的用法,帮助你更好地掌握Linux文本操作。 2. touch命令的用法 touch命令的基本语法如下: t…

    Shell 2023年5月16日
    00
  • Linux中SELinux、Shell简介、touch命令的应用小结

    以下是关于“Linux中SELinux、Shell简介、touch命令的应用小结”的完整攻略,其中包含两个示例说明。 1. SELinux简介 SELinux是一种安全增强的Linux内核安全模块,它可以提供更加细粒度的访问控制,保护系统免受恶意攻击。以下是SELinux的基础知识: SELinux可以通过策略文件来定义安全策略。 SELinux可以通过标签…

    Shell 2023年5月16日
    00
  • Linux 中的 Install命令

    以下是关于“Linux 中的 Install 命令”的完整攻略,其中包含两个示例说明。 1. 前言 在Linux系统中,install命令是一个常用的命令,它可以将文件复制到指定的目录,并设置文件的权限和属性。本攻略将介绍如何使用install命令来安装文件。 2. 实现方法 2.1 基本语法 install命令的基本语法如下: install [OPTIO…

    Shell 2023年5月16日
    00
  • linux shell 管道命令(pipe)使用及与shell重定向区别

    以下是关于“Linux Shell 管道命令(pipe)使用及与 Shell 重定向区别”的完整攻略,其中包含两个示例说明。 1. 前言 在 Linux Shell 中,管道命令(pipe)和重定向(redirection)是非常常用的命令。本攻略将介绍如何使用管道命令和重定向,并讨论它们之间的区别。 2. 管道命令 管道命令是一种将一个命令的输出作为另一个…

    Shell 2023年5月16日
    00
  • 一个简单的linux命令 touch

    以下是关于“一个简单的Linux命令touch”的完整攻略,其中包含两个示例说明。 1. 前言 touch是Linux系统中的一个常用命令,用于创建空文件或修改文件的时间戳。本攻略将介绍touch命令的基本用法和示例说明,帮助你更好地掌握Linux系统的命令行操作。 2. 基本用法 touch命令的基本语法如下: touch [OPTION]… FILE…

    Shell 2023年5月16日
    00
合作推广
合作推广
分享本页
返回顶部